In the digital age, the size of data has become a crucial factor for efficient storage and transmission. One measurement commonly used to quantify data size is bytes. A byte is a unit of digital information that typically consists of 8 bits, each representing a binary value of 0 or 1. It is widely used to measure file sizes, memory capacity, and data transfer rates.

In the world of social media and online communication, the concept of 140 bytes is often associated with platforms like Twitter, where the maximum character limit for a tweet used to be 140.
However, it is essential to clarify that a byte is not equivalent to a character. In the English language, characters are typically encoded using the ASCII standard, which assigns a unique numerical value to each character. Most English characters are represented by one byte (8 bits) in ASCII encoding. Therefore, in terms of ASCII characters, a tweet limited to 140 bytes would allow for approximately 140 characters.
However, modern platforms like Twitter now use Unicode encoding, which provides support for a much wider range of characters, including emojis and symbols from various languages. Unicode characters often require more than one byte to represent them accurately.
